UPVC & Composite Door
The uPVC front door is an amazing upgrade for your home, it adds security for your family and home, and also improves the thermal efficiency. They are also a cheaper alternative to composite doors and are available in a variety of colours to fit the style of your home. There are many additional elements to pick from too, such as letterboxes, door handles and even knockers and spyholes.
Composite doors are an innovative technological advancement in door technology. They offer a range of aesthetics, durable colour options, and a variety of extra features that you can add to your door. They can be customised with realistic woodgrain finishes and a vast choice of glasswork inserts to meet the needs of any taste or style. They are also easy to maintain and do not require painting or staining, just a wipe down with a damp cloth and soapy water to keep them looking as great as new.
The uPVC front door is built on the same premise as the plastic-sheen UPVC windows derby you have in your home or seen installed at neighbouring properties. They are durable and affordable however they don't offer the same level of security as composite doors. UPVC is made of polymers that are mixed together and is a stiff and hard material that makes it less flexible than composite door.
Automatic Sliding Doors
Automatic sliding doors provide an array of advantages to the client. They are very popular in shopping centers and airports because they allow everyone to easily enter your building regardless of age or mobility. They can also help maintain hygiene standards in places like hospitals. The spread of germs is decreased because people are less likely to touch the door.
The sensor opens the door when it detects someone or movement. It then sends a signal to the motor mechanism, which then causes the output shaft of the gearbox belt pulleys to rotate and move the doors panels forward. Once the sensors have no longer sense any further movement, they stop spinning and return to the original position.
Doors can be set up in various ways. Some are suspended from above-head tracks and are slid over the floor plane, while others are set in a frame that connects with both the floor and overhead planes. They are available in bi-part or single slide configurations, and can be built to meet a wide variety of handling requirements.
In the event of a crisis the telescopic automatic sliding doors can move to one side. These doors are commonly located in the corridors of schools and public buildings.
Automatic Swing Doors
Automatic swing doors can be a great solution for people with disabilities or older people who have difficulty to open or close doors manually. They permit easy access to facilities like hospitals, schools and comfort rooms without the need to push a heavy or hard-to-open door. They can be activated either by a hand-free sensors or a push button. They also come with a variety of activation options like proximity sensors and infrared motion detectors.

Commercial Doors
Commercial doors are designed with practicality that will give professional appearance to your business and assist you save energy and security as well as space optimization. The doors are available in a variety of designs, colors, and finishes. They are also available in various sizes and types of materials. These doors are made from robust materials that can endure a variety of weather conditions and meet fire safety standards.
Steel doors are a great option for commercial buildings due to their durability, strength and endurance. They are commonly used in warehouse sheds garages, as well as other industrial buildings of all kinds. They can be customized using different door hardware, glass kits and louvers. These doors can also be rolled up or opened and closed using the push-pull handle.
Another popular option for commercial doors is aluminum. These doors are a good option for schools, since they are fire-rated for up to an hour. They can keep the residents and equipment protected until firefighters arrive. They are also easy to maintain and have an attractive appearance.
Other popular options for commercial interior doors are sliding and bypass door systems. Bypass doors consist of two or more offset panels which stack on top of each other to make room when they are opened. They are popular in closets in hotels and apartments because they save storage space. Sliding door systems are an alternative to swing doors which use a track and rollers to slide into place. They can be customized to meet a variety of specifications for example, ADA accessibility and blast protection.
